    Mandragora successfully blends metroidvania and soulslike elements, offering meaningful character progression and excellent dialogue filled with bizarre characters. It’s wrapped in a striking dark fantasy aesthetic and backed by a strong soundtrack. However, the experience stumbles in frustrating platforming sections where a single mistake can mean death, especially during repeated treks to boss fights. The main story also never rises above a basic and predictable premise. It’s not a masterpiece, but still a very solid soulslike that will keep you entertained for many evenings, even if it occasionally drives you mad.

    It would be easy to let Mandragora fade into the crowd of Soulslike Metroidvanias, but it’s so much more than the sum of its parts. I’ve avoided a lot of Soulslike games over the years for what felt to me like focusing on difficulty to the exclusion of all else. But while Mandragora can be extremely punishing, it’s a reminder that difficulty can also be an expression of a game’s world, and pushing through that challenge can be far more satisfying than completing a game that doesn’t take such pleasure in pushing players to their limits. Mandragora is one of the most nerve-wracking games I’ve played in years, and I’m already eager to pick up another of its classes and wallow in its infuriating joy all over again.
